π Why Are People Afraid of AI?
πΌ Job Losses
Imagine this: Robots making your coffee ☕, driving your cab π!Sounds cool? For businesses, yes. For workers, not so much.
According to recent studies, millions of jobs in manufacturing, transportation, and even white-collar sectors are at risk of automation.πΉ️ Loss of Control
AI learns fast—sometimes faster than we expect. What if we lose control over what it does?
Example: An AI algorithm making medical decisions without human approval could lead to life-threatening errors.π£ AI Weaponization
AI isn’t just about cute chatbots—it can also power autonomous weapons, deepfakes, and cyberattacks. In the wrong hands, AI could spark digital wars!π§ Superintelligence
The ultimate fear: AI surpasses human intelligence and decides it no longer needs us. This is the “sci-fi apocalypse” scenario we see in movies like Terminator.
While this is still theoretical, the speed at which AI is evolving makes people wonder if it’s really that far-fetched.
π€ Reality Check: Can AI Really Take Over?
Here’s the truth: AI today is “narrow AI”—it can perform specific tasks incredibly well (think ChatGPT writing essays or Tesla Autopilot driving a car), but it doesn’t think like humans. It has no emotions, creativity, or common sense beyond what it’s trained for.
For AI to “take over,” we would need Artificial General Intelligence (AGI)—a type of AI that can think, learn, and reason like humans.
✅ Is AGI real? No, not yet.
✅ Is it coming soon? Maybe in decades, maybe never.
But before we even get there, the misuse of current AI (deepfakes, hacking, biased decisions) is already causing trouble. That’s why prevention matters NOW.
✅ How Do We Prevent an AI Takeover?
Here’s what governments, companies, and individuals should do:
1. π©⚖️ Create Strong Global Regulations
AI shouldn’t be a “wild west.” Countries need clear laws on:
✔️ Data privacy
✔️ AI use in weapons
✔️ Ethical decision-making
Example: The EU AI Act is one step toward regulating AI for fairness and safety.
2. ⚙️ Teach AI Human Values (Value Alignment)
We need to build AI that understands ethics. Think of it as giving AI a moral compass π§ so it knows what’s right and wrong.
3. π§ Keep Humans in Control (Human-in-the-Loop)
Important decisions like medical diagnoses, legal rulings, or military actions should always have a human in charge—not just an algorithm.
4. π Build Explainable AI
No more black boxes! If AI says “No loan for you”, you should know why. Transparent AI builds trust and prevents bias.
5. π Educate People About AI
Knowledge is power!
If students, professionals, and even everyday users understand AI’s limits and strengths, they’ll use it responsibly.
6. π Global Cooperation
AI is global. If one country races ahead without rules, everyone else suffers. We need international treaties to prevent misuse—just like nuclear weapons treaties.
